#include "gui.h"
#include "gui_defs.h"
#include "x.h"
#include <sys/select.h>
#include <stdio.h>
#include <stdlib.h>
#include <errno.h>
#include <string.h>
#include <unistd.h>
void gui_loop(gui *_gui)
{
struct gui *g = _gui;
int xfd;
int eventfd;
int maxfd;
fd_set rd;
/* lock not necessary but there for consistency (when instrumenting x.c
* we need the gui to be locked when calling any function in x.c)
*/
glock(g);
xfd = x_connection_fd(g->x);
gunlock(g);
eventfd = g->event_pipe[0];
if (eventfd > xfd) maxfd = eventfd;
else maxfd = xfd;
while (1) {
glock(g);
x_flush(g->x);
gunlock(g);
FD_ZERO(&rd);
FD_SET(xfd, &rd);
FD_SET(eventfd, &rd);
if (select(maxfd+1, &rd, NULL, NULL, NULL) == -1)
ERR("select: %s\n", strerror(errno));
glock(g);
if (FD_ISSET(xfd, &rd))
x_events(g);
if (FD_ISSET(eventfd, &rd)) {
char c[256];
if (read(eventfd, c, 256)); /* for no gcc warnings */
}
gui_events(g);
if (g->repainted) {
struct widget_list *cur;
g->repainted = 0;
cur = g->toplevel;
while (cur) {
struct toplevel_window_widget *w =
(struct toplevel_window_widget *)cur->item;
x_draw(g->x, w->x);
cur = cur->next;
}
}
gunlock(g);
}
}
